今天来分享几个前端文件处理相关的实用工具库!1、PDF(1)PDF.jsPDF.js是使用HTML5构建的可移植文档格式(PDF)查看器。它由社区驱动并受Mozilla支持,目标是创建一个通用的、基于Web标准的平台来解析和呈现PDF。Github(⭐️39.2k):https://github.com/mozilla/pdf.js。(2)jsPDFjsPDF是一个使用JavaScript语言生成PDF的开源库,是一个用于生成PDF的领先的HTML5客户端解决方案。Github(⭐️24.6k):https://github.com/parallax/jsPDF。(3)pdfmake在纯Jav
请看这段代码。在下面的代码中,用户可以上传图片,他们可以移动、调整大小、旋转上传的图片等。$(function(){varinputLocalFont=$("#user_file");inputLocalFont.change(previewImages);functionpreviewImages(){varfileList=this.files;varanyWindow=window.URL||window.webkitURL;for(vari=0;i",{class:"img-div"});var$newImg=$("",{src:objectUrl,class:"newly-a
简介:版本号:1.1.64–多学校版本本次更新内容:订单问题修复(无需上传小程序)版本号:1.1.63–多学校版本本次更新内容:失物招领增加内容安全接口;认证增加性别选择;(需要重新上传小程序)搭建教程:适用类型微信小程序测试环境:系统环境:CentOSLinux7.6.1810(Core)、运行环境:宝塔Linuxv7.0.3(专业版)、网站环境:Nginx1.15.10+MySQL5.6.46+PHP-7.1/PHP-5.6、常见插件:ionCube;fileinfo;redis;Swoole;sg111、上传到微擎框架应用目录安装应用,进入应用后台配置小程序参数2、用微信开发折工具导入小
问题描述:使用npm或yarn进行安装依赖包时,无响应超时,随即设置镜像源指向淘宝镜像,但始终不生效。问题原因:无响应——网络等原因,导致npm或yarn装包失败;设置镜像不生效——项目中的.npmrc文件或.yarnrc已经配置镜像源路径,优先以这个为准。问题解决:修改项目中的.npmc文件或.yarnrc配置,例如设置为淘宝镜像,如下图拓展知识点:npm读取配置文件优先级如下:P1——项目配置文件(/project/.npmrc),项目根目录下的.npmrc文件,仅用于管理本项目的npm安装;P2——用户配置文件(~/.npmrc),使用账号登陆电脑时,可以为当前用户创建一个.npmrc文
我在网上搜索过这个问题,但没有一个对我有帮助。这个也没有:chgrpapache/path/to/mydirchmodg+w/path/to/mydir我的服务器是centos7,你能帮帮我吗? 最佳答案 尝试使用以下命令:这将为您提供apache用户的名称。ps-ef|grepApache|grep-vgrep在大多数情况下,用户将是www-data。进入/frontend/web文件夹后运行这些命令:sudochgrpwww-data./assets和sudochmodg+w./assets/您的问题将得到解决。
我们正在与许多非专业翻译人员合作:即我们海外分支机构的人员。我想使用PO文件,但让30多个不熟练的人来编辑它们是有问题的。我想要一个Web前端来编辑这些-理想情况下是PHP,因为其他所有内容都在其中。是否有成熟的Web前端可以信任在五年内保持最新状态? 最佳答案 您不需要翻译应用程序是php只是因为要翻译的原始应用程序是用php编写的(尽管它可能更容易安装和管理,因为您熟悉它)。你可以使用Pootle(使用Python和Django框架)。它完全满足您的需求:一个用于编辑.po文件的Web界面。亲眼看看exampleforanAbi
目录前言什么是WebSocketWebSocket的工作原理WebSocket与HTTP的关系HTTP建立持久化连接WebSocket类封装前言最近写项目,需要实现消息通知和实时聊天的功能,就去了解了一些关于websocket的知识,总结如下。什么是WebSocketWebSocket是一种在Web应用中实现实时通信的协议。与传统的HTTP请求不同,WebSocket连接在客户端和服务器之间建立一个持久性的双向通信管道,使得数据可以在连接打开后随时传递。这消除了HTTP请求的开销,能更好的节省服务器资源和带宽,同时在实时应用中提供了更好的性能和响应性。WebSocket就像是你和服务器之间的一
本文章转载于公众号:王清江唷,仅用于学习和讨论,如有侵权请联系QQ交流群:298405437本人QQ:42063591►数据库的创建和初始化SQL的执行当我们下载好了Ruoyi-Vue之后,我们得到一个文件夹,如下:内部又有若干文件,如下:这里面不仅包括了后端程序(基于SpringBoot的Java程序),也包括前端程序(基于Vue的程序,文件夹“ruoyi-ui”)。!特别注意鉴于前后端都在一个项目里面,强烈推荐分离开。将“ruoyi-yi”文件夹独立出来,剪切出来和RuoYi-Vue并列。导入后端将后端导入IDEA,当我们IDEA在手,天下我有。直接把RuoYi-Vue整个文件夹拖入IDE
楔子--青蛙跳台阶一只青蛙一次可以跳上一级台阶,也可以跳上二级台阶,求该青蛙跳上一个n级的台阶总共需要多少种跳法。分析: 当n=1的时候,①只需要跳一次即可;只有一种跳法,即f(1)=1;当n=2的时候,①可以先跳一级再跳一级,②也可以直接跳俩级;共有俩种跳法,即f(2)=2;当n=3的时候,①一阶一阶跳即可;②他可以从一级台阶上跳俩阶上来③也可从二级台阶上跳一阶上来;即共有f(3)=f(2)+f(1);所以当有n阶台阶时,且当n>2的时候,根据上面式子可推导出→ f(n)=f(n-1)+f(n-2)图片所以很直白的看出就是个 斐波那契数列 ,有一点不同的是,斐波那契数列从1,1,2,3,5,
作为前端开发工程师,我们需要了解哪些命令?如果您熟悉这些命令,它们将大大提高您的工作效率。1. tree小伙伴们,你们知道如何列出一个目录的文件结构吗?它在显示文件之间的目录关系方面做得很好,这真的很酷。commands├──a.js├──b.js├──c.js├──copy-apps│└──fe-apps│└──a.js├──fe-apps│└──a.js├──test.log└──xxx└──yyy在此之前,您需要安装命令树。brewinstalltree然后只需在文件目录中执行tree即可。2.wcwc是wordcount的缩写,常用于文件统计。它可以统计字数、行数、字符数、字节数等。我